What it is, How it works

Hair analysis is increasingly recognized as a potent method for identifying drug and alcohol consumption. Hair accumulates a historical record of alcohol and drug use by capturing biomarkers in the hair's growing fibers. When collected near the scalp, hair can offer up to a roughly 3-month detection period for alcohol and other substances. It is straightforward to collect, challenging to tamper with, and convenient to send.

A 1.5-inch section of about 200 hair strands (approximately the width of a #2 pencil) nearest the scalp yields 100mg of hair, considered the optimal sample size for preliminary and confirmatory testing. For EtG, additional tests, or tests over 10 panels, a 150mg sample is advised. We suggest weighing the hair sample using a jeweler's scale. If scalp hair isn't available, a comparable amount of body hair can be obtained. Mention of head hair pertains solely to scalp hair, whereas body hair includes all other types (facial, armpit, etc.).

Process Overview

The principal steps in laboratory processing of a drug test outcome include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ning entails the preliminary entry of a sample into a lab's system. This step involves ensuring the sample's seal and shipping integrity, assigning it a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and finalizing any further data input not covered by an electronic chain of custody system.

Screening represents an initial rapid assessment for substances of abuse. Although Screening is a budget-friendly method for excluding drug use in most samples, a positive screen must be verified to be legally defensible. Samples that are initially positive in Screening necessitate additional confirmation.

Should a sample test presumptively positive during Screening, additional hair is retrieved from the original sample and readied for Extraction. In this phase, drugs are isolated from hair at a notably lower concentration than other techniques (e.g., urine or oral fluid), which accounts for the complexity of hair drug screening.

Verification of any positive screening result is carried out using G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S methods. Every presumptive positive sample is cleansed before confirmation as required. The entire lab procedure from Accessioning to Confirmation undergoes scrutiny per the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air standards and accreditation under ISO/IEC 17025 guidelines.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Extended detection period: Hair drug tests can discover drug consumption for up to 90 days, in contrast to the brief detection period of urine tests.
  • Resistance to deception: Cheating on a hair drug test is extremely challenging, augmenting the accuracy of the outcomes.
  • Offers historical insights: It can reveal a pattern of drug consumption over time, rather than just recent instances.

Limitations:

  • Inability to identify recent consumption: Drugs only become detectable in hair after about 5-7 days.
  • Expense: Hair drug tests generally incur greater costs than other screening approaches.
  • Result variability: Aspects such as hair pigmentation and individual hair growth differences can modulate drug metabolite concentrations in hair.

Note: Though often termed "hair follicle tests", the analysis examines the hair strand as opposed to the follicle beneath the scalp

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

Frequently Asked Questions

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
Yes. If the donor's head hair is too short or unavailable, body hair may be collected as an alternative. The collector will document the source of the sample. This allows testing even for individuals with recently cut or shaved head hair.
